First time posting Hi! 😁

Just bought a 2001 525i with the 2.5 litre straight 6 engine. Needed the crankcase ventilation system replacing... someone had completely bypassed it off to a catch can and the poor custom pipework was causing leaks everywhere! Anyway... all back to stock now with the new insulated CCV and pipes.

When I was in the process of disconnecting everything and came to remove the throttle body i notice a connector hanging loose to the right... further around the back of the engine and looks as though the wire is clipped up/fastened. I believe it's where the EGR is on some of the BMW engines?

Used a mirror try and look further behind for any sockets missing connector but cant see anything?

Ive attached an image - Please can someone advise? Makes me nervous having a connection just hanging there with nothing to plug into

Morning Matt Welcome to the Forum 

Take a look at www.newtis.info it is a BMW Technical Information site, the same information as BMW Dealers use you should be able to find an answer there. You could also try www.pelicanparts.com it is an American site so steering wheel on the wrong side but good information and how too's with step by step pictures.

For parts information www.realoem.com just put the last 7 digits of your Vin in the search box and it will bring up your model.

Hope these help
